We have an exciting opportunity for a Dynamics 365 CRM Engineer to play a key role in delivering the COMET CRM transformation programme. They will design, develop, and deploy scalable Microsoft Dynamics 365 and Power Platform solutions, with a strong focus on DevOps, automation, and enterprise-grade ALM.

The ideal candidate will have deep technical expertise, hands-on development capability, and experience driving CI/CD and release processes across complex environments.

What you will do:

  • End-to-end delivery of Dynamics 365 CRM solutions across the full software lifecycle
  • Design and implement scalable, secure, and high-performing CRM architectures
  • Own and manage Azure DevOps pipelines, ensuring robust CI/CD practices
  • Automate build, test, and deployment processes across multiple environments
  • Manage solution lifecycle including versioning, patching, and release governance
  • Collaborate with architects, business analysts, and stakeholders to define technical solutions
  • Provide technical leadership and mentoring to development teams
  • Ensure adherence to DevOps, ALM, and coding best practices
  • Troubleshoot and resolve complex technical and deployment issues

What we are looking for:

  • Dynamics 365 CRM (Senior-Level Expertise)
  • Extensive experience with Microsoft Dynamics 365 CE (Sales, Customer Service, etc.)
  • Advanced customization and configuration: Entities, forms, views, dashboards
  • Business rules, workflows, business process flows
  • Strong development experience: C# plugins and custom workflow activities
  • JavaScript / TypeScript
  • Dataverse Web API / SDK
  • Deep understanding of: Solution management (managed/unmanaged), Solution layering, segmentation, and version control
  • Power Platform
  • Expertise in: Power Apps (Model-driven and Canvas apps), Power Automate (complex flows and orchestration), Power Pages (portal design, authentication, and security models)
  • Strong Dataverse data modelling and governance experience
  • Azure DevOps & CI/CD
  • Extensive hands-on experience with Azure DevOps: Repos, Boards, Pipelines, and Artifacts
  • Design and maintenance of YAML-based pipelines
  • Experience running and optimising pipelines, including: Build automation, Release pipelines, Multi-stage deployments
  • Implementation of CI/CD for Dynamics 365 solutions using: Power Platform Build Tools, PAC CLI
  • ALM (Application Lifecycle Management)
  • Strong experience implementing Azure DevOps ALM strategies: Branching strategies (e.g., GitFlow), Environment strategies (Dev, Test, UAT, Prod), Automated solution promotion across environments, Dependency and release management best practices
  • Build, Release & Automation
  • Automating: Solution export/import, Environment provisioning, Configuration/data migration, Managing deployment pipelines with approvals and rollback strategies
  • Experience with configuration migration and data seeding
  • Data & Integration
  • Strong knowledge of: Dataverse architecture and data modelling, Data migration strategies
  • Integration experience using: REST APIs and web services, Azure services (Functions, Logic Apps, Service Bus)
  • Understanding of security, compliance, and access control
  • Quality, Testing & Monitoring
  • Experience with: Automated testing approaches (unit/UI testing), Pipeline monitoring and troubleshooting, Performance tuning and optimisation of CRM solutions
  • Leadership & Collaboration
  • Proven ability to lead technical design and delivery
  • Strong stakeholder engagement and communication skills
  • Experience mentoring developers and promoting DevOps culture

Desirable Skills:

  • Microsoft certifications (PL-600, PL-400, AZ-400)
  • Experience with Power BI integration
  • Familiarity with infrastructure-as-code (ARM/Bicep)
  • Exposure to AI Builder / Copilot capabilities
